About this job
Executes interior design services for commercial real estate properties and produces/distributes required working drawings by performing the following duties personally:
Responsibilities
Prepare test fits/space plans and pricing notes for prospective tenants as required
Prepare building stacking plans
Assist TI Project Managers in preparing tenant improvement budgets
Assist construction and property management teams with finish selections on select capital projects
Prepare marketing plans for vacant spaces
Prepare smaller space surveys for existing vacancies and note exiting conditions
Prepare Construction Documents for Interior tenant improvement projects in Revit
Maintain up to date product library and pricing for finish materials
Assist with the design and selection of finishes for select base building renovations
Maintain electronic library of all Design Documentation, Revit, AutoCAD files, Sketch-up, etc. Rev
Assist with the maintenance of the operations and maintenance documents & project plans
Assist with the Coordination of all design related tasks of tenant improvement projects in the Austin, Texas market.
Assist with the Coordination of all Landlord work elements for all tenant managed projects
Intermediate to Advance proficiency in the following Software: Revit, AutoCAD, Sketch-up and EnScape
Novice to Intermediate proficiency in the following Software: Adobe Photoshop, InDesign and Illustrator
Must be able to demonstrates the ability to work autonomously with minimal guidance.

EDUCATION and/or EXPERIENCE
Bachelor's degree in Architecture (BArch or BSArch) or in Interiors from four-year college or university and/or equivalent master’s degree in architecture, Interior Architecture, or Interior Design.
Applicants with 4-10 years related experience and/or training; or equivalent combination of education and experience will be considered.
Experience with using architectural computer software as noted: Proficiency in AutoCAD and Revit is required. Proficiency in Sketch-up, Photoshop, Illustrator, InDesign and BlueBeam is preferred.
Experience executing workplace space plans in CAD and Revit is preferred.
Proficiency in developing a finish palette and coordinating with a finish, furniture and equipment vendor is preferred.
